Support

If you're buying a couch, consider the amount of assistance it offers. A sagging sofa can become lumpy and uncomfortable, while a strong frame will remain firm after years of lounging, snacking, and watching TV. For the best mix of comfort and sturdiness, select a piece that functions both foam and fiber fill in the seat and back cushions. These types of pillows hold their shape much better and are easier to tidy than feather or down options.

When shopping for a comfortable couch, look for one with a durable frame. Avoid frames made from plastic or particleboard, which are more susceptible to warping and can be hard to clean. Strong wood frames, such as oak or ash, are the very best option. They're likewise simple to clean and a more eco-friendly choice than metal.

Another essential element to consider when picking a couch is its fabric. The product will affect just how much the sofa expenses, how quickly it can be cleaned up, and its durability. Many natural and synthetic materials, such as cotton and linen, are low-cost. Others, such as silk and wool, are more expensive however likewise lasting.

If you're concerned about allergies, it might be worth paying more for a premium organic cotton or linen sofa. These fabrics are naturally anti-bacterial, breathable, and resistant to mold and mildew. Synthetic fabrics are less costly but may still cause responses for some individuals.

To evaluate a couch's comfort, muffle it and wiggle around to see how the cushions move. An excellent quality couch ought to be flexible and springy without being too stiff. It should likewise be helpful and offer a good level of back support.

Material

When looking for a new couch, think about the material. The kind of material you choose can impact how long the sofa will last and whether it will keep its shape after a great deal of use. Numerous types of couch materials are offered, consisting of natural fibers like cotton, linen, and wool and artificial efficiency materials such as polyester and olefin. Each has its own set of advantages and disadvantages.

Natural fibers are usually more pricey, but they will also last longer and may have the ability to hold up against more wear and tear than other couch materials. However, they might be more susceptible to stains and need more regular cleansing. Artificial materials like polyester and olefin can resist discolorations and wrinkles and are more inexpensive. They likewise can be found in a variety of colors and can be woven to imitate natural fibers.

If you're fretted about allergic reaction reactions, you can decide for a sofa that is certified to reduce air-borne contaminants. You can also find sofas made from recycled materials, which decreases the amount of waste in landfills. Some brand names even use buy-back or trade-in programs to encourage reuse.

Size

Shoppers who focus on comfort should remember that the size of a couch affects how it feels to sit on it. Preferably, the couch must fit the room and complement the other furnishings pieces, however it should not feel too big or large. When looking at couches online, shoppers ought to inspect the dimensions to figure out how comfortable a sofa is in an area. Likewise, an excellent guideline is to test the sofa by resting on it for a prolonged duration. Examine how it feels to sit on the sofa with and without extra pillows, which may conceal back-cushioning concerns.
